How to Choose the Right Coaching Approach

When you look for expert recommendation in padel training, start by matching the coaching style to your current level and goals. Some players need technical foundations such as grip consistency, shot contact, and positioning before they can benefit from padel coaching malaysia advanced tactics. Others already understand basic rally patterns and want coaching that sharpens decision-making under pressure. A good coaching pathway feels progressive rather than random, with each session building on the previous one.

It also helps to consider how your coach evaluates improvement. The most effective programs observe your footwork, balance, and paddle angle, then prescribe drills that directly target the weak link. Ask whether the coach uses video review, live corrections during drills, or structured feedback after practice. You’ll get faster results when feedback is specific, actionable, and repeated across multiple sessions until the movement becomes automatic. This is especially important if you aim to compete or improve your court awareness.

What Expert Coaches Emphasize in Training

Professional coaching should treat padel as a full system: technique, movement, and strategy all work together. Expect training to include controlled hitting patterns for rhythm, then progress to rally simulations that force you to choose between safety and aggression. Coaches often padel malaysia focus on the right moment to attack using lobs, bandeja timing, and controlled drive variations. They also help you reduce unforced errors by improving spacing on defense and preparing early for the next shot.

A strong session plan typically balances repetition with variation. For example, a coach might begin with forehand accuracy drills, then transition to cross-court pressure routines where you learn how to keep the opponent moving. In doubles-style situations, you should practice partner coordination such as covering the center, communicating before shots, and adjusting for your partner’s strengths. This team awareness is a major difference between casual play and match-ready performance, and it accelerates your learning curve on court.

Training Structure and Skill Pathways for Different Players

Beginner pathways usually emphasize reliable fundamentals: correct paddle position, stable stance, and safe contact points. Coaches may use simplified drills that highlight where the ball should land and how to recover your position after each swing. You’ll also learn how to read the court dimensions, use the glass effectively, and understand basic shot selection. With a consistent structure, you avoid building bad habits that can be hard to fix later.

For intermediate and advanced players, sessions often shift toward tactical refinement. That can include learning how to vary height and pace, recognizing opponent patterns, and selecting the best response to returns. You may also work on serve and receive routines, aiming to start points with intent rather than hope. Many players benefit from match-based practice where the coach sets targets like forcing a weaker side, maintaining cross-court control, or improving transition after a winning shot. This kind of goal-driven training builds confidence and helps you perform under real match conditions.
